di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 2acdc9a..cef4270 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-10,44 +10,44 @@ permissions: contents: read jobs: - publish-linux: - runs-on: ubuntu-latest - strategy: - fail-fast: false - matrix: - python-version: - # - ["3.8", "cp38"] - - ["3.9", "cp39"] - - ["3.10", "cp310"] - - ["3.11", "cp311"] - platform: ["manylinux_x86_64"] - steps: - - uses: actions/checkout@v3 - - name: Set up Python ${{ matrix.python-version[0] }} - uses: actions/setup-python@v4 - with: - python-version: ${{ matrix.python-version[0] }} - cache: pip - cache-dependency-path: setup.py - - name: Install dependencies - run: | - pip install setuptools wheel numpy transonic psutil twine build - - name: Build wheels - uses: pypa/cibuildwheel@v2.12.1 - env: - CIBW_BUILD: ${{ matrix.python-version[1] }}-${{ matrix.platform }} - CIBW_BUILD_FRONTEND: "build" # "pip" - with: - output-dir: "dist" - config-file: "pyproject.toml" - - name: Publish - env: - TWINE_USERNAME: __token__ - TWINE_PASSWORD: ${{ secrets.TWINE_API_KEY }} - run: | - git tag - twine upload dist/*manylinux*.whl --verbose - continue-on-error: true +# publish-linux: +# runs-on: ubuntu-latest +# strategy: +# fail-fast: false +# matrix: +# python-version: +# - ["3.8", "cp38"] +# - ["3.9", "cp39"] +# - ["3.10", "cp310"] +# - ["3.11", "cp311"] +# platform: ["manylinux_x86_64"] +# steps: +# - uses: actions/checkout@v3 +# - name: Set up Python ${{ matrix.python-version[0] }} +# uses: actions/setup-python@v4 +# with: +# python-version: ${{ matrix.python-version[0] }} +# cache: pip +# cache-dependency-path: setup.py +# - name: Install dependencies +# run: | +# pip install setuptools wheel numpy transonic psutil twine build +# - name: Build wheels +# uses: pypa/cibuildwheel@v2.12.1 +# env: +# CIBW_BUILD: ${{ matrix.python-version[1] }}-${{ matrix.platform }} +# CIBW_BUILD_FRONTEND: "build" # "pip" +# with: +# output-dir: "dist" +# config-file: "pyproject.toml" +# - name: Publish +# env: +# TWINE_USERNAME: __token__ +# TWINE_PASSWORD: ${{ secrets.TWINE_API_KEY }} +# run: | +# git tag +# twine upload dist/*manylinux*.whl --verbose +# continue-on-error: true publish-windows: runs-on: windows-latest